网页打开不显示:服务器端口隐形之谜

资源类型:00-9.net 2025-01-03 23:29

打开网页看不到服务器端口简介:



探索网络迷雾:为何打开网页却看不到服务器端口? 在当今这个数字化时代,互联网已经成为我们生活和工作不可或缺的一部分

    无论是浏览社交媒体、在线购物、还是远程办公,我们无时无刻不在与网页进行交互

    然而,当我们轻轻一点,网页如魔术般呈现在眼前时,背后隐藏的复杂网络机制却常常被我们所忽视

    特别是当我们遇到“打开网页却看不到服务器端口”的现象时,这种忽视便尤为明显

    本文旨在深入探讨这一现象,揭示其背后的原理,并阐述为何普通用户在正常使用网页时几乎察觉不到服务器端口的存在

     一、网页访问的幕后英雄:服务器端口 首先,让我们来揭开服务器端口的神秘面纱

    在网络通信中,服务器端口是服务器用来监听和接收来自客户端(如我们的电脑、手机等设备)请求的逻辑地址

    每个服务器都可以运行多个服务,每个服务都通过特定的端口进行通信

    例如,HTTP服务通常使用80端口,而HTTPS服务则使用443端口

    这些端口就像是服务器上的一个个“门”,不同的服务通过不同的“门”与外界进行交互

     然而,当我们通过浏览器访问一个网页时,通常并不会直接看到这些端口号

    这是因为现代浏览器和Web服务器之间已经建立了一套完善的协议和机制,使得这一过程对用户来说变得透明和无缝

     二、浏览器与Web服务器的默契配合 当我们在浏览器的地址栏中输入一个网址(如www.example.com)并按下回车键时,浏览器会立即开始一系列复杂的操作来解析和访问这个网址

    首先,浏览器会查询DNS服务器,将网址转换成对应的IP地址

    这个IP地址就像是服务器在网络中的“物理地址”,它告诉浏览器要去哪里找到服务器

     一旦获得了IP地址,浏览器就会尝试与服务器建立连接

    这里的关键在于,浏览器会自动使用默认的HTTP或HTTPS端口(即80或443端口)来发起连接请求

    除非用户特别指定了其他端口(这种情况非常罕见),否则浏览器不会显示或要求用户输入端口号

     服务器在收到浏览器的连接请求后,会根据请求的端口号来决定由哪个服务来处理这个请求

    如果请求的是80端口,那么服务器上的HTTP服务就会接管这个请求,并返回相应的网页内容

    如果请求的是443端口,则HTTPS服务会进行加密通信,确保数据传输的安全性

     三、为什么用户看不到服务器端口? 现在,我们回到了最初的问题:为什么用户在使用浏览器访问网页时看不到服务器端口?这主要有以下几个原因: 1.用户体验的简化:浏览器和Web服务器之间的通信过程被设计得非常简洁和高效,以确保用户能够快速、无障碍地访问网页

    如果每次访问网页都需要用户输入端口号,那么这将极大地降低用户体验,并增加用户的认知负担

     2.默认端口的广泛应用:HTTP和HTTPS服务使用的80和443端口是互联网上最常用的两个端口

    由于这两个端口已经被广泛接受和应用,因此浏览器可以默认使用它们来发起连接请求,而无需用户手动指定

     3.安全性的考虑:隐藏端口号还可以在一定程度上提高安全性

    如果端口号对用户可见且可配置,那么攻击者可能会尝试利用其他非标准端口来发起攻击

    而通过将端口号隐藏在幕后,浏览器和Web服务器可以共同维护一个相对安全的通信环境

     四、特殊情况下端口号的可见性 尽管在大多数情况下用户看不到服务器端口,但在某些特殊情况下,端口号还是会“浮出水面”

    例如: - 非标准端口的Web服务:如果某个Web服务运行在非标准的端口上(如8080、8443等),那么用户在访问该服务时通常需要手动输入端口号

    这种情况通常发生在测试环境、内网服务或特定应用上

     - URL重定向:有时,服务器可能会将用户重定向到另一个端口上的服务

    在这种情况下,用户可能会在浏览器的地址栏中看到端口号的改变

     - 开发者工具:对于熟悉网络开发的用户来说,他们可以使用浏览器的开发者工具来查看和分析网络请求

    在这些工具中,用户可以看到每个请求的详细信息,包括请求的URL、端口号、请求头等

     五、总结与展望 综上所述,“打开网页看不到服务器端口”这一现象是浏览器和Web服务器之间默契配合的结果

    通过隐藏端口号,浏览器为用户提供了一个简洁、高效且安全的网页访问体验

    然而,这并不意味着端口号在网络通信中不重要或不存在

    相反,它们是网络通信中不可或缺的一部分,扮演着至关重要的角色

     随着网络技术的不断发展,我们可以预见未来浏览器和Web服务器之间的通信机制将会更加复杂和智能

    例如,随着HTTP/2和HTTP/3等新一代网络协议的推广和应用,浏览器和服务器之间的通信将变得更加高效和可靠

    同时,随着网络安全威胁的不断演变和升级,浏览器和服务器也将需要采取更加先进的安全措施来确保用户数据的安全性和隐私性

     在这个过程中,虽然用户可能仍然看不到服务器端口的存在,但我们可以肯定的是,这些端口将继续在幕后默默工作,为我们提供稳定、快速且安全的网页访问服务

    因此,当我们下次在浏览器中轻轻一点,享受着网页带来的便利和乐趣时,不妨也向那些隐藏在幕后的英雄们致以崇高的敬意

    

阅读全文
上一篇:“墨寒SEO最新排名揭秘:优化策略大放送”

最新收录:

  • 网页无法加载?找不到服务器怎么办
  • 点击链接,服务器却无法打开?
  • 文件共享服务器开启失败解决方案
  • 解压失败!服务器异常警示
  • 打开服务器图片:揭秘内部景象
  • 一码通服务器出错,打开遇障解析
  • 解锁云服务器:一键开启的必备命令
  • 在线服务器异常:打开遇阻解决方案
  • 大庆SEO网页优化技巧揭秘
  • 代码优化技巧:提升网页SEO效果
  • 大华服务器网页中文设置指南
  • SEO优化:打造高效企业网页内容策略
  • 首页 | 打开网页看不到服务器端口:网页打开不显示:服务器端口隐形之谜